"Filmstrip" view doesn't work in Explorer

In Windows Explorer, when I try to view the contents of a pictures folder in filmstrip view, instead of providing a preview of each photo above a long line of them, it just shows thumbnails at the top of the page, with a scrollbar at the bottom, and all the photos going off the edge of the window. I'm sure the folders are photo folders, I'm sure it's set to Filmstrip view, the drive is NTFS - there's no reason for it not to work. Does anyone have an idea why this might be happening?

Relevant information:

Computer is Genuine Windows XP Media Center 2005, SP2

Intel Core Duo processor

1 Gb RAM

All updates, etc. applied

I haven't had any viruses or other major problems (to my knowledge)

Any idea what's causing this? Here's a screenshot:

Oh! And clicking on "View as Slideshow" doesn't work, either. However, it all works fine when I open the file in Windows Picture and Fax Viewer and click view as slide show, etc.

I found how to fix it "officially" on the Dell website. :thumbup In case anyone else ever finds this problem, you may want to read this article:

http://support.dell.com/support/topics/glo...;l=en&s=gen

All you have to do is run the file: "regsvr32 /i shimgvw.dll", and it fixes itself. Not sure how, but it works, and that's the important part, right? :yes:
